Sinton Has No Hard Feelings


Chris Sharp In the Mix At Grimsby Last Saturday
Telford boss Andy Sinton says he has no hard feelings towards Chris Sharp following his move to Edgar Street.

Surprisingly, the Bucks failed to insert a clause in Sharp's transfer blocking him from playing in tonight's match. Sinton told the local press:

"Chris has gone to a full-time club and we wish him well. I will be delighted to see him again but, hopefully, he doesn’t really get going on the night. We know all about Chris, his strengths, and we will have to combat them and we will get on with it.”

Sinton will have veteran striker Steve Jones back from a four match ban for tonight's game. The 36 year old was sent off in their FA Trophy loss at King's Lynn, in just his second game after coming back from a three match ban. Sinton is glad to have him back, but told the press he wasn't particularly happy about losing him to suspension for seven of nine games:

“He comes back into our squad and he is a big player who we have missed. But we haven’t missed him because he has been left out. He has been missed through his own stupidity.”
